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den window units in existing or new constructions. This process typically includes removing outdated or damaged windows, preparing the window openings, and fitting the new wooden frames and sashes securely. Skilled installers ensure that the windows are properly aligned and sealed to prevent drafts, water intrusion, and air leaks. Proper installation not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of a property but also contributes to improved energy efficiency and overall comfort within the space.

These services address common problems such as drafts, difficulty in opening or closing windows, and deterioration due to age or weather exposure. Older wooden windows may develop rot, warping, or gaps that compromise insulation and security. Installing new wooden windows can help resolve these issues by providing a tighter seal and more durable materials. Additionally, replacement windows can reduce energy costs by improving insulation, and they often require less maintenance compared to older, worn-out units.

Material Costs - The cost of wood window materials typ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the type of wood and design complexity. Higher-end options like custom or hardwood windows may cost more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ific choices.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ees usually fall between $200 and $500 per window, varying with project size and window accessibility. Complex installations or older homes may incur higher labor costs. Contact local contractors for precise quotes.

Additional Fees - Extra costs such as removal of old windows, framing adjustments, or finishing can add $50 to $200 per window. These fees depend on the scope of work and existing conditions. Local service providers can clarify potential additional charges.

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for installing wood windows typically range from $400 to $1,300 per window, combining materials, labor, and extras. Prices vary based on window size, style, and location. Pros can offer tailored cost estimates for specific proj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
